Changing the save location for the Signatures file

T

toejoe2k

The current location for Signatures to be saved is ...\Documents and
Settings\%profile%\Application Data\Microsoft\Signatures.

How can I configure a different save location?

Playing with roaming profiles on our network. E.U.'s here don't manage their
profiles properly and causes long log-on times and excessive network traffic.

Our workstations are all XP Pro. We've excluded the application data folder
from the profile save (on log-off) and are seeing some problems with corrupt
profiles. It would be very nice to be able to configure the save location
for certain components of Outlook (cached e-mail address list that is
suggested as you type in the "To:" field of a new message, for example. Also
the signatures that E.U.'s create.

I seem to remember that there was a reg. entry that identified the default
save location for these things but, I cannot find it again.

You can configure a folder other than "Signatures" via registry setting, but
it must be a subfolder of
%AppData%\Microsoft.
